The DHS concerto competition is an annual event to choose one student musician at DHS who will perform with the DHS Symphony Orchestra and receive a $500 award. The winner will have the opportunity to play his or her piece with the orchestra at the annual Wennberg Concert scheduled for Saturday, April 8, 2017 at 2:30pm at the Mondavi Center. What music should be played for the competition? The competition piece should be a movement from a concerto. It is required that the contestants memorize their piece for both the competition and the MondaviPerformance. The competition is a recital format. Note: The musicians should provide their own accompanists and two copies of the music for the judges. Who may compete? The competition is open to the entire DHS student population. A musician who won this competition in a previous year may not compete again. What instrument may competitors play? Competitors may play any appropriate instrument for which concertos are written. When and where is the competition being held? This year?s competition will be held Wednesday, January 11, 2017 at 7:00 P.M. DHS Richard Brunelle Performance Hall. It is open to the public, free admission. When does the winner perform with the orchestra? Well? here is my answer: The Coconut Grove diner and concert is a 25 year tradition with the DHS Bands as the primary fund raiser. The concept is similar to the Madrigal Dinner that has been going on for longer than that. The DHS Jazz Band has a tradition of being very good. In the past the Jazz Band was regularly invited to perform at the Monterey Jazz Festival as well as other prestigious events. So the thought was to emulate an old time Jazz Night Club and run it as a fundraiser for all of the DHS Bands. Back when we were allowed to keep individual student accounts for fund raisers many students (through participation credit) were able to fully fund their major trip expenses by participating in various fundraisers including Coconut Grove. This participation is: helping with the event, set-up & take-down, serving, stage management, Master of Ceremonies, sound, etc. Since we can no longer keep student accounts everything is required to go into the general fund. A portion of the monies made go to subsidize the total cost of the major trip each year. Other parts goes to pay for all of the other band expenses (instrument repair & acquisition, festival entrance fees, concert recordings, new music, section coaches, etc.) The event itself includes performances by the Jr. High jazz bands, Celia Cottle jazz bands, as well as the headliner DHS Jazz Band and Combos. There is a catered dinner. Over the years it has been catered by many different local restaurants and caterers. We have not settled on who will cater this year but we will be continuing with serving each table ?family style? which was started last year. Since this is held on a school campus we can?t have actual cocktails, so instead recipes have been refined over the years for mocktails which are served at the mocktail bar. Additionally, there is a silent auction and raffle at the event. The name Coconut Grove comes from the ?World Famous Coconut Grove?. There were actually many Coconut Groves that started in the 1920?s. At least one of which lasted into the 1980?s. Coconut Grove was a jazz nightclub similar to the Cotton Club or the Tropicana. The two most famous were in Boston and Los Angeles. The Boston club was famous by virtue of being run by a mobster and burning to the ground killing a lot of people. The Los Angeles club was in the Ambassador Hotel and had famous headliners all the time while the hotel was regularly host to presidents and dignitaries. The Ambassador Hotel was frequented by celebrities, some of whom, such as Pola Negri ,[1] resided there. From 1930 to 1943, six Academy Awards ceremonies were performed at the hotel. Perhaps as many as seven U.S. presidents stayed at the Ambassador, from Hoover to Nixon , along with chiefs of state from around the world. For decades, the hotel's famed Cocoanut Grove nightclub hosted well-known entertainers, such as Frank Sinatra , Barbra Streisand , Judy Garland , Lena Horne , Nancy Wilson , Bing Crosby , Nat King Cole , Liza Minnelli , Martin and Lewis , The Supremes , Merv Griffin , Dorothy Dandridge , Vikki Carr , Evelyn Knight , Vivian Vance , Dick Haymes , Sergio Franchi , Perry Como , Dizzy Gillespie , Benny Goodman , Sammy Davis Jr. , Little Richard , Liberace , Natalie Cole , and Richard Pryor . The hotel served alcoholic beverages during the Prohibition . An interesting video of and about the club is https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=NOHF5fAUkN4.
